Why Does Grout Fail After Water Exposure?

When water sits on or around your tiled surfaces, it doesn’t just sit there. It actively works to break down the materials it comes into contact with. Grout, which is typically a porous mixture of cement, sand, and water, is especially vulnerable. The water essentially washes away some of the cement binder that holds the grout together.

The Science Behind Grout Breakdown

Grout is designed to fill the gaps between tiles and provide a stable surface. However, it’s not waterproof. When exposed to water for extended periods, several things can happen. The water can penetrate the porous structure of the grout. This penetration can lead to a chemical breakdown of the cementitious binder. Think of it like a sugar cube dissolving in water; the structure weakens and disintegrates.

Erosion of the Cement Binder

The cement in grout is what gives it its strength and hardness. Water can leach out this cement over time. This leaves the grout with less structural integrity. It becomes softer and more prone to chipping and crumbling. This is a primary reason why grout can fail after prolonged water exposure. It’s a slow, insidious process that weakens the entire tiled area.

Freeze-Thaw Cycles and Expansion

In colder climates, water trapped within grout can freeze. When water freezes, it expands. This expansion creates immense pressure within the microscopic pores of the grout. Repeated freezing and thawing cycles can cause micro-cracks to form. Over time, these tiny cracks grow larger. They eventually lead to noticeable crumbling and failure of the grout lines. This is a common issue in areas exposed to outdoor elements or unheated spaces.

The Role of Sealing and Porosity

Grout is naturally porous. This means it can absorb liquids. Proper sealing is crucial to prevent water damage. A good quality sealant creates a barrier on the grout’s surface. This barrier slows down water absorption. If your grout is unsealed or the sealant has worn away, water can penetrate much more easily. This increases the risk of grout failure. Regular resealing is a vital part of grout maintenance. Without it, even minor water exposure can become a problem.

When Sealant Fails

Sealants don’t last forever. They can degrade over time due to cleaning chemicals, foot traffic, and general wear and tear. When a sealant fails, the grout beneath it becomes exposed. It’s like taking the lid off a can of paint; the contents are now vulnerable. This is when you might start noticing your grout darkening or feeling softer.

Impact on Surrounding Materials

Grout doesn’t exist in isolation. It’s part of a larger system. When grout fails due to water, it can affect other components. The subfloor beneath the tiles can become saturated. This can lead to rot and structural damage. The adhesive holding the tiles can also weaken. This can cause tiles to loosen and even pop off. The problem with grout failure is often just the tip of the iceberg.

Subfloor Weakening

A wet subfloor is a ticking time bomb. Wood subfloors can rot and lose their structural integrity. This makes the entire floor unstable. Even concrete subfloors can be compromised by persistent moisture. This can lead to cracks and further damage. Addressing water issues quickly is essential to protect your home’s foundation.

Tile Adhesion Issues

Water can seep between tiles and reach the adhesive. This can break down the bond between the tile and the subfloor. As the grout crumbles, it loses its ability to hold tiles firmly in place. This can result in loose tiles or tiles that start to lift. You might notice a “hollow” sound when walking on certain areas.

Common Causes of Grout Failure Related to Water
Cause Effect on Grout Prevention/Mitigation
Prolonged Water Exposure Weakens cement binder, erosion Seal grout regularly, fix leaks promptly
Freeze-Thaw Cycles Causes micro-cracks, expansion damage Ensure proper drainage, insulate if possible
Worn or Damaged Sealant Allows water penetration Inspect and reseal grout every 1-2 years
Poor Subfloor Drainage Saturated subfloor, indirect grout damage Ensure proper slope and drainage around tiled areas
Harsh Cleaning Chemicals Can degrade sealant and grout over time Use pH-neutral cleaners specifically for tile and grout
